Benzinga - On CNBC’s "Halftime Report Final Trades," Bryn Talkington of Requisite Capital Management named Visa Inc . (NYSE: NYSE:V), which is down just 5% this year, and has high free cash flow yields and also high margins.
Visa released a paper earlier this year outlining how the firm could work with Ethereum (CRYPTO: ETH) to enable automated payments from self-custodial crypto wallets. The concept includes a proposed Ethereum protocol named “Account Abstraction,” which would allow Ethereum user accounts to function like smart contracts. This solution provides complete control of funds when using a self-custody wallet.
